Recommended by SAS WebJan 27, 2024 · By default, SAS date and time variables are printed using the SAS internal values, rather than a "human-readable" date format. However, dates can be displayed using any chosen format by setting the format in a data step or proc step. (For a full listing of date-time formats, see About SAS Date, Time, and Datetime Values.)
